England allocates millions for food vouchers: who can receive help.
Support for households
According to The Sun: Thousands of families facing difficult situations can receive supermarket vouchers worth £100 to cover Christmas expenses. But don’t delay.
The vouchers are provided through the Household Support Fund, which was established from government funding. Each council in England was allocated a portion of the £742 million from this fund to support needy residents.
"These vouchers are intended to help those most in need,"government representatives emphasize.
Those wishing to receive vouchers should contact their local councils. They will identify eligible candidates and assist in gathering the necessary documents to receive help.
This initiative aims to support the most vulnerable segments of the population during the holiday season. Local councils have already begun the process of distributing vouchers, so potential recipients should not delay their visit to take advantage of this opportunity.
